Description

Although no definite rule exists for determining whether a consultant is an independent contractor or an employee, certain provisions in the agreement will help to insure that the relationship reflects the intention of the parties.

Definition and meaning

A Contract with Consultant for Business Planning, Organization and Management Services is a legally binding agreement that outlines the terms and conditions under which a consultant will provide advisory services to a company. This type of contract specifies the scope of the consultant's work in advising on business planning, organization, and management strategies.

Key components of the form

The contract includes several essential components that ensure clarity and mutual understanding between the consultant and the company. Key components include:

  • Scope of Services: Detailed description of the consulting services to be provided.
  • Compensation: Clearly defined payment terms, including fees and payment schedules.
  • Confidentiality Clause: Provisions to protect sensitive company information shared during the consulting process.
  • Termination Clause: Conditions under which either party may terminate the agreement.

Common mistakes to avoid when using this form

When completing the contract, be aware of the following common pitfalls:

  • Failing to clearly define the scope of services, which can lead to misunderstandings.
  • Ignoring the confidentiality clause, exposing sensitive information.
  • Not reviewing the contract thoroughly before signing, which can result in agreeing to unfavorable terms.
  • Overlooking the need for written modifications, which can nullify verbal agreements made later.

While many consultants focus on one area of specific expertise, management consultants are focused on helping leadership of an organization improve overall performance and operations. Management consultants are often engaging with C-Suite level executives and working on complex issues.

A Consulting Services Agreement is a contract - either written or verbal - which sets out the terms and conditions for service between a Customer and a Consultant.

The consulting agreement is an agreement between a consultant and a client who wishes to retain certain specified services of the consultant for a specified time at a specified rate of compensation.

The short answer is that the Consultants role is evaluate a client's needs and provide expert advice and opinion on what needs to be done while the Contractors role is generally to evaluate the client's needs and actually perform the work.At that point the Consultant may be said to become a Contractor.

The market rate is the average price and range of pricing a typical customer will pay for your type of consulting service. If the average business consultant charges and receives $100 per hour, than the market rate is likely between $50 to $150 per hour.

Consultant agreements are important because they outline what work will be done, as well as the terms of the agreement between the client and the consultant. A consultant agreement should be detailed and include compensation terms, contract termination, intellectual property ownership and confidentiality agreements.
